Why choosing the right truck size matters
Picking the right truck is one of the most important parts of a successful move. A vehicle that is too small can mean extra trips, more time, and greater fatigue. A vehicle that is too large may be difficult to park, awkward on narrow streets, or unnecessary for a smaller flat move. In West Hampstead, where parking space can be at a premium, choosing the right size is especially important.
For studio and one-bedroom flats, a smaller removal truck may be appropriate, particularly if access is straightforward and you are moving a modest amount of furniture. For larger flats, maisonettes, and family homes, a bigger truck may be the better choice, especially if you are transporting wardrobes, beds, dining tables, white goods, and multiple box loads. The aim is to match the truck to the real volume of the move, not guess and hope for the best.
If you are unsure, it is better to speak through the details in advance. Tell the team about stair access, lift availability, any large or awkward items, and whether the property has controlled parking. A sensible recommendation can help prevent last-minute pressure and keep the move on schedule.

Preparation checklist before moving day
Good preparation makes removal truck hire far more effective. Even if you are hiring a truck with loading help, there are still simple steps you can take to save time and reduce stress. The more organised your belongings are before the truck arrives, the smoother the process usually becomes.
- Pack boxes securely and label them by room where possible.
- Keep valuables, passports, and important documents separate.
- Defrost and clean fridges or freezers in advance if they are being moved.
- Disassemble large furniture if this has been arranged and is safe to do so.
- Reserve parking or note any restrictions that may affect the truck.
- Measure doorways, stairwells, and lifts for bulky items.
- Set aside fragile items so they can be handled with extra care.
You should also think about access on both sides of the move. If you are leaving a flat in West Hampstead and moving to another London property, ask whether the destination has a lift, loading bay, or parking constraint. Sharing that information in advance helps the team plan properly and avoid delays. A little preparation can save a lot of time on the day.
Pricing factors for removal truck hire
Because every move is different, prices are usually shaped by several practical factors rather than a single fixed amount. This is helpful for customers because it means the quote can better reflect the real job, whether it is a small flat move or a larger relocation with multiple heavy items. Understanding these factors can make it easier to compare options confidently.
Common pricing factors include truck size, journey distance, loading time, waiting time, the number of movers required, and whether stairs, lifts, or difficult access are involved. The nature of the load also matters. A move involving fragile furniture, gym equipment, or bulky appliances may require more care and time than a simple box transfer. The more details you provide upfront, the more accurate the quote is likely to be.
Additional services, such as dismantling and reassembly, multiple pick-up points, or short-notice scheduling, can also affect the overall cost. If you are trying to stay within a budget, it is usually better to discuss the full requirements openly so the plan can be tailored sensibly. Practical tips for a smoother moving day
Moving day tends to run more smoothly when the details are handled early. Small actions can prevent avoidable delays and help the removal truck be used more efficiently. A few practical habits are especially useful in West Hampstead, where access and parking can be tricky.
- Be ready before the truck arrives so loading can start promptly.
- Keep pathways clear inside the property.
- Wrap fragile items and label them clearly.
- Separate essentials you will need immediately after arrival.
- Make sure someone is available to answer access questions.
- Check in advance if building rules apply to moving times.
If you are moving with children, pets, or a busy work schedule, it can help to create a simple timetable for the day. The less you need to make decisions on the spot, the easier the move usually feels.
